Seriously, I'll be the first to admit when you're starting out and you're dropping solo, this game is lousy. It's hard, it's heavily dependent on coordination, and without much experience you're likely to get stomped more often than not. We've all been there. So I encourage everyone to check out the Houses and the Merc Corps to locate a group of like-minded players that you can join. Every house forum has a recruitment area, and the Merc Corps are no different. Go there, scan the posts, see if you may be interested in joining a clan. It really will make a world of difference in how you feel playing MWO. There's groups out there for everyone, so put yourself out there and give a few of them a try.

Now when I was in the beta I could just jump in, play, and didn't have much trouble with shooting or anything, in fact my aim was steady. I'm on a new machine now, and the changes to the game have resulted in... Unsteadiness. It doesn't lag per say, but once I'm in a firefight even my steady hand is jerking around, the mouse is all over the place, and my target reticule will skip, jump, and hop at odd and skewed angles, like rising at a forty-five degree angle and then dropping downward even though I'm just trying to pan right.
I've tried adjusting the ingame mouse settings but it's just not helping. Am I losing my mind or is there an adjustment I can make?
